Morgan State vs. Bridgewater State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Morgan State or Bridgewater State?

  • Morgan State University is 501.9% more expensive to attend than Bridgewater State for in-state tuition ($5,477.00 vs. $910.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 126.2% higher at Morgan State than Bridgewater State University ($15,948.00 vs. $7,050.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Morgan State University than Bridgewater State ($13,956 vs. $17,225)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Morgan State University are 16.4% lower than costs at Bridgewater State University ($12,162 vs. $14,162)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Morgan State University than Bridgewater State University (99% vs. 82%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Morgan State University students is 47.8% larger than aid received Bridgewater State University ($12,738 vs. $8,616)

Morgan State vs. Bridgewater State Admissions Difficulty Comparison

Which college is harder to get into, Morgan State or Bridgewater State? Average SAT and ACT scores plus acceptance rates offer good insight into the difficulty of admission between Bridgewater State or Morgan State .

  • The average SAT score at Bridgewater State University (996) is 118 points higher than at Morgan State (878)
  • Incoming Bridgewater State students have a 4 point higher average ACT score (22) than students at Morgan State (18)
  • Accepted freshman Bridgewater State students have a 0.11 point higher average high school GPA (3.21) than students at Morgan State (3.1)
  • Bridgewater State has a higher acceptance rate (87.7%) than Morgan State (85.4%)

Morgan State vs. Bridgewater State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Morgan State or Bridgewater State?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Bridgewater State and Morgan State.

  • The graduation rate at Bridgewater State is higher than Morgan State University (52% vs. 28%)
  • Graduates from Bridgewater State University earn on average $4,800 more per year than Morgan State graduates after ten years. ($45,700 vs. $40,900)
  • Bridgewater State University students graduate with a $6,410 lower median federal student loan debt than Morgan State graduates. ($24,590 vs. $31,000)
  • Bridgewater State graduates are paying $66 less per month on federal student loans than Morgan State graduates. ($254 vs. $320)
  • More Bridgewater State gra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Morgan State students, three years after graduation. (64% vs. 22%)
